Course details

• Introduction to Quantum Computing & Quantum Hardware  
• Quantum Bits (Qubits) & Quantum States  
• Quantum Gates & Quantum Circuits  
• Quantum Error Correction & Quantum Noise  
• Quantum Algorithms & Quantum Protocols  
• Quantum Cryptography & Quantum Key Distribution  
• Quantum Machine Learning & Quantum Data Analysis  
• Quantum Simulation & Quantum Emulation  
• Quantum Architecture & Quantum Design  
• Quantum Programming & Quantum Software Development
